An online master's degree is a fully digital programme that allows students to complete their studies remotely. This means you can access lectures, submit assignments, and interact with professors and peers through an online platform. In our system, any master’s programme that is entirely online is considered an online master's degree. This flexibility enables international students to pursue their education without relocating, making it an ideal option for those balancing work, family, or other commitments.

Online master’s degrees in Educational Leadership offer numerous benefits for international students. Studying online provides unparalleled flexibility, allowing you to learn from anywhere in the world at your own pace. This means you can balance your studies with work or personal life more effectively. Additionally, online programmes can often be more cost-effective, as they may eliminate the need for relocation and commuting expenses. Pursuing a master’s in Educational Leadership online equips you with specialised knowledge and skills that are in high demand in the education sector. Graduates often find enhanced career opportunities, such as roles in school administration, curriculum development, or educational consultancy.   • Admission requirements for an online master's in Educational Leadership typically include a recognised bachelor's degree, often in education or a related field. Most programmes require a minimum GPA, usually around 2.5 to 3.0 on a 4.0 scale. Additionally, applicants may need to submit letters of recommendation, a personal statement, and a resume highlighting relevant experience. Some programmes may also require standardised test scores, such as the GRE, although this is becoming less common. It's important to check specific programme requirements as they can vary.

  • Online Educational Leadership programmes are highly interactive. Most programmes use a variety of tools and platforms to facilitate engagement, such as discussion boards, video conferencing, and collaborative projects. Students often participate in live lectures, webinars, and virtual office hours with instructors. Group work and peer reviews are common, ensuring that students remain engaged and connected throughout their studies. The interactive nature of these programmes helps replicate the classroom experience, fostering a sense of community among online learners.

  • Online master's programmes in Educational Leadership offer a range of specialisations to cater to different career goals and interests. Common specialisations include Curriculum and Instruction, Educational Administration, Special Education Leadership, and Higher Education Leadership. These specialisations allow students to focus their studies on specific areas of interest within the field of Educational Leadership. Choosing a specialisation can help students develop expertise in a particular area, making them more competitive in the job market. It's important to research programme offerings to find the specialisation that aligns with your career aspirations.
